If I were a tidy person I’d have files of ideas, neatly catalogued and waiting to be used. Instead, when enthusiasm strikes I follow a theme compulsively until it has been interpreted in glass. I love the varied colours and textures of glass; it’s unpredictability; and the way that it looks different every time the weather changes.
Faces with a Story was inspired by articles about two people, an African nomad and an Indian poet/farmer, whose life experiences are carved into their faces. The light illuminates their facial features, but particularly the eyes, which tell a story of their own.
